Biography

Pedrinho played for Brazil at the 1972 München Olympics. Playing with Internacional in Porto Alegre, he won four Brazilian Championships. He would later play for Atlético-MG, where he led them to the final of the 1980 Brazilian Championship, losing to Flamengo. Pedrinho ended his career with stints with Coritiba, Vasco, Bangu, and then Avaí.
